The highly anticipated TikTok Awards Sub-Saharan Africa lit up Johannesburg last night, delivering a masterclass in glitz, glam, and viral energy. The event was anchored by the incomparable Bontle Modiselle-Moloi, whose hosting skills were as sharp as her multiple outfit changes. She kept the energy peaking, proving once again why she is South Africa’s premier entertainment personality. The night was a celebration of the creators who have defined culture over the past year.
Musical performances were the heartbeat of the evening, with Ciza bringing the house down. His chemistry on stage was electric, and when joined by Lord Kez for a soulful rendition, the crowd went wild. It wasn’t just about the awards; it was a full-blown concert that showcased the best of African talent. Social media is currently ablaze with clips of the performances, solidifying Ciza’s status as a superstar.
From the red carpet looks to the emotional acceptance speeches, the event was a triumph. Influencers and celebs mingled in what is being described as the ‘party of the year.’ The vibe was unadulterated joy, a stark contrast to the usual stiff award ceremonies. Timeline
- Dec 6, 2025 (18:00): Red carpet arrivals begin; fashion trends set.
- Dec 6, 2025 (20:00): Bontle Modiselle-Moloi opens the show.
- Dec 6, 2025 (21:30): Ciza and Lord Kez perform viral hits.
- Dec 6, 2025 (23:00): After-party kicks off in Sandton.
